A militarised version of the Austin K30 30-cwt truck chassis was the basis for this ambulance, known as the K2 chassis to which they fixed a boxy body made by coach-builders Mann Egerton. The load area had been developed by the Royal Army Medical Corps and was capable of carrying up to ten seated casualties or four stretcher …
WebAustin K30, 30-cwt (1.5-ton), 4x2, GS. A few batches of the 500 British Austin trucks, delivered to Russia from late 1941 to 1942, were Austin K30 s. The one shown here is a later model, with the same closed civilain-type cab and large single rear tires instead of the previous dual rears.
